The system operates as a Windows service and includes an administration GUI tool to manage domains, accounts, and server parameters. It supports the major open email standards, making it highly compatible with popular email clients like Outlook or Thunderbird. Core Technical Features

Pre-Installation Checklist Before running the installer, prepare your environment: Static IP: Ensure your server has a static local IP address. Firewall Ports: Prepare to open ports (POP3), and hMailServer includes a built-in Microsoft SQL Server Compact database for small setups. For larger installations, have PostgreSQL credentials ready. 3. Step-by-Step Installation Run the Installer: Double-click the downloaded file and accept the license agreement. Select Components: Choose "Full installation" to include both the Administrative tools Database Server: "Use built-in database" if you want a quick, zero-config setup. "External database" to connect to your own SQL server. Security Password: Create a strong Main Administration Password
